As a Human Resource Operations Senior Associate, you will play a pivotal role in managing the people lifecycle and day-to-day operational tasks related to employee management. This includes activities such as onboarding, offboarding, payroll and benefits administration, absence management, and compliance with labor laws. You will be a primary HR point of contact, resolving inquiries and issues, and supporting HR processes to run smoothly within our HR Managed Services practice.

Responsibilities

  • Managing the employee lifecycle, including onboarding, offboarding, and employee record-keeping
  • Coordinating payroll and benefits administration to support workforce needs
  • Handling employee inquiries and issues, escalating or routing them as necessary
  • Administering compliance with labor laws and regulations within HR operations
  • Utilizing HR software to streamline processes and enhance service delivery
  • Supporting employee engagement strategies and fostering a positive work environment
  • Implementing process improvements to optimize HR operations and service delivery
  • Collaborating with stakeholders to address complex business issues from strategy to execution
  • Maintaining confidentiality and integrity of employee data and information
  • Analyzing HR metrics to inform insights and recommendations for business improvement
